Siddaramaiah not trying to topple govt: DKS

Last Updated 26 October 2018, 10:33 IST

Water Resources Minister D K Shivakumar on Sunday said former chief minister Siddaramaiah was not making any attempt to topple the coalition government.

Speaking to reporters in Bengaluru, Shivakumar went to the extent of hailing Siddaramaiah. “Siddaramaiah is a good and a genuine leader. He is not trying to topple the government. It is common for senior leaders to be politically ambitious and aspirational. His remarks are, however, being misinterpreted. I have stood behind Siddaramaiah like a rock for four and a half years (when he was the chief minister) and worked with him. We did try our best to make him the chief minister again, but to no avail,” he said, adding there were no differences of opinion among the ministers.

Shivakumar also took a dig at the BJP for trying to dislodge the government. “This is not a pot, for it to be broken into pieces in one go. The BJP leaders should be patient,” he said.
